Verb: infuse  in'fyooz
  1. Teach and impress by frequent repetitions or admonitions
    - inculcate, instill
     
  2. Fill, as with a certain quality
    "The heavy traffic infuses the air with carbon monoxide"
    - impregnate, instill, tincture
     
  3. Undergo the process of infusion
    "the mint tea is infusing"
     
  4. Let sit in a liquid to extract a flavour or to cleanse
    "infuse the blossoms in oil"
    - steep
     
  5. Introduce into the body through a vein, for therapeutic purposes
    "Some physiologists infuses sugar solutions into the veins of animals"

Derived forms: infuses, infused, infusing

See also: infusion

Type of: drill, fill, fill up, imbue, inject, make full, shoot, soak
